(填空题)
0-1背包问题的回溯算法所需的计算时间为(),用动态规划算法所需的计算时间为()。
正确答案
O(n*2n);O(min{nc,2n})
答案解析
略
相似试题
(填空题)
用回溯法解0/1背包问题时,该问题的解空间结构为()结构。
(填空题)
用回溯法解题的一个显著特征是在搜索过程中动态产生问题的解空间。在任何时刻,算法只保存从根结点到当前扩展结点的路径。如果解空间树中从根结点到叶结点的最长路径的长度为h(n),则回溯法所需的计算空间通常为()
(简答题)
用贪心算法设计0-1背包问题。要求:说明所使用的算法策略;写出算法实现的主要步骤;分析算法的时间。
(简答题)
使用回溯法解0/1背包问题:n=3,C=9,V={6,10,3},W={3,4,4},其解空间有长度为3的0-1向量组成,要求用一棵完全二叉树表示其解空间(从根出发,左1右0),并画出其解空间树,计算其最优值及最优解。
(简答题)
举反例证明0/1背包问题若使用的算法是按照pi/wi的非递减次序考虑选择的物品,即只要正在被考虑的物品装得进就装入背包,则此方法不一定能得到最优解(此题说明0/1背包问题与背包问题的不同)。
(简答题)
描述0-1背包问题。
(简答题)
流水作业调度中,已知有n个作业,机器M1和M2上加工作业i所需的时间分别为ai和bi,请写出流水作业调度问题的johnson法则中对ai和bi的排序算法。(函数名可写为sort(s,n))
(填空题)
回溯法的算法框架按照问题的解空间一般分为()算法框架与()算法框架。
(单选题)
程序块()是回溯法中遍历排列树的算法框架程序。